Output 907d53a7edcad035a965ff67fd8f7be57e9a19791bf65b308826cdea3ff673a4:3

value
583792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6effdf712a17382e53b04697d16d629b97c09fee OP_EQUAL
address
3BovmzyQmQ91KrPhst2KH6Dt8PUFcr6n4F
transaction
907d53a7edcad035a965ff67fd8f7be57e9a19791bf65b308826cdea3ff673a4
spent
true